CAS:2444-36-2
Molecular Formula:C8H7ClO2
O-Chlorophenylacetic Acid; 2-Cl-Phenylacetic Acid; O-Cl-Phenylacetic Acid; 2-Chloro Phenyl Acetic ACID
Brief Introduction
This product is the intermediate of diclofenac, and also used in the synthesis of diclofenac.
CAS:24549-06-2
Molecular Formula:C9H13N
MEA; 2-Methyl-6-Ethylaniline (Mea); 2-Ethyl-6-Methyl-Phenylamine; 2-Ethyl, 6-Methylaniline(MEA); Benzenamine,2-Ethyl-6-Methyl; 2-Ethyl-6-Methylbenzenamine; Aniline,2-Methyl-6-Ethyl; Benzenamine, 2-Ethyl-6-Methyl-; 2-Ethyl-5-Methylphenylamine; 6-Methyl-2-Ethyl-Aniline; 6-Ethyl-2-Toluidine; 2-Methyl-6-Ethylaniline; 6-Ethyl-O-Toluidine; O-Toluidine,6-Ethyl
Brief Introduction
2-methyl-6-ethylaniline is an important pesticide, dye and pharmaceutical intermediate. Pesticide field is the key intermediate for the production of herbicide acetochlor, and can also be used in other organic synthesis.

CAS:2687-25-4
Molecular Formula:C7H10N2
3-Methyl-1,2-Phenylenediamine; 1,2-Diamino-3-Methylbenzene; 1,2-Benzenediamine, 3-Methyl-; 2,3,5,6-Tetrafluoro-4-(Trifluoromethyl)Phenylacetic Acid; 2-Amino-3-Methylaniline; 2,3-Toluylenediamine; 2,3-Toluenediamine; Vic-O-Tolylenediamine; Toluene-2,3-Diamine; Tolylene-2,3-Diamine; 3-Methylbenzene-1,2-Diamine; 3-Methyl-O-Phenylenediamine; 2,3-Tolylenediamine; Ortho-Diaminotoluene; 3-Methylphenylene-1,2-Diamine; 2,3-Toluilenediamine; 3-Methyl-1,2-Diaminobenzene; 2,3-Diaminotoluene(3-Methyl-O-Phenylenediamine); 2.3-Diaminotol; 2-Benzenediamine,3-Methyl-1; 3-Methyl-1,2-Benzenediamine; 3-Methyl-1,2-Phenylenediamine[Qr]
Brief Introduction
2,3-diaminotoluene is used as an organic and pharmaceutical intermediate. It is an inducer of CYP1A activity and a potential mutagenic carcinogen.
